From 37aa0bc72714c9ec98b50bd3fa9504cd92e67114 Mon Sep 17 00:00:00 2001 From: zhouz <> Date: Fri, 30 May 2025 15:31:43 +0800 Subject: [PATCH] =?UTF-8?q?fix=EF=BC=9A=E4=BC=98=E5=8C=96B1=E5=88=86?= =?UTF-8?q?=E5=88=87=E4=B8=8A=E6=96=99=EF=BC=8C=E6=8F=90=E9=86=92=E6=B2=A1?= =?UTF-8?q?=E6=9C=89=E5=8F=AF=E7=94=A8=E7=9A=84=E5=86=B7=E5=8D=B4=E5=8C=BA?= =?UTF-8?q?=E6=8F=90=E7=A4=BA=E9=80=BB=E8=BE=91?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../pda/mps/service/impl/FeedingServiceImpl.java | 16 ++++++++++++++++ .../src/views/wms/agvrush/charge/index.vue | 12 ++++++------ 2 files changed, 22 insertions(+), 6 deletions(-) diff --git a/lms/nladmin-system/src/main/java/org/nl/wms/pda/mps/service/impl/FeedingServiceImpl.java b/lms/nladmin-system/src/main/java/org/nl/wms/pda/mps/service/impl/FeedingServiceImpl.java index 26e118d65..5be27bdd2 100644 --- a/lms/nladmin-system/src/main/java/org/nl/wms/pda/mps/service/impl/FeedingServiceImpl.java +++ b/lms/nladmin-system/src/main/java/org/nl/wms/pda/mps/service/impl/FeedingServiceImpl.java @@ -427,6 +427,22 @@ public class FeedingServiceImpl implements FeedingService { task_jo.put("point_code2", pointArr.getString("point_code")); + // 2.找冷却区空货位 + JSONObject cool_map = new JSONObject(); + cool_map.put("flag", "2"); + cool_map.put("product_area", cool_jo.getString("product_area")); + cool_map.put("point_location", "0"); + + JSONObject jsonCooIvt = WQL.getWO("PDA_OVENINANDOUT_01").addParamMap(cool_map).process().uniqueResult(0); + // 如果为空 + if (ObjectUtil.isEmpty(jsonCooIvt)) { + cool_map.put("point_location", "1"); + jsonCooIvt = WQL.getWO("PDA_OVENINANDOUT_01").addParamMap(cool_map).process().uniqueResult(0); + } + if (ObjectUtil.isEmpty(jsonCooIvt)) { + throw new BadRequestException("冷却区空位不足"); + } + //将分切机的点位作为目的点,桁架任务完成时,自动创建AGV任务 task_jo.put("point_code3", next_point_code); task_jo.put("material_code", cool_jo.getString("container_name")); diff --git a/lms/nladmin-ui/src/views/wms/agvrush/charge/index.vue b/lms/nladmin-ui/src/views/wms/agvrush/charge/index.vue index bb2d0ffd6..5b8f17409 100644 --- a/lms/nladmin-ui/src/views/wms/agvrush/charge/index.vue +++ b/lms/nladmin-ui/src/views/wms/agvrush/charge/index.vue @@ -33,7 +33,7 @@ -